Noun:
- John
- Mary
- School
- Hospital
- Apple
A noun names a person, place, things, or idea.
Adverb:
- Always
- Never
- Soon
- Loudly
- Late
An adverb tells how often, how, when, where.
Verb:
- Are
- Take
- Plays
- Walk
- Sing
A verb is a word or group of words that describes an action, experience.
Adjective:
- Beautiful
- Red
- Tall
- Short
- Sour
An adjective describes a noun or pronoun.
Preposition:
- At
- In
- On
- About
- For
A preposition is used before a noun, pronoun, or gerund to show place, time, direction in a sentence.
Conjunction:
- Therefore
- Moreover
- Because
- Yet
- And
Conjunctions join words or groups of word in a sentence.
Pronoun:
- He
- Him
- She
- Her
- This
Pronouns replace the name of a person, place things, or idea in a sentence.
Interjection:
- Yehey!
- Oops!
- Aha!
- Bravo!
- Phew!
Interjections express strong emotion and is often followed by an exclamation point.
